1 #include<iostream> 2 class NODE 3 { 4 public: 5 int data; 6 NODE *next; 7 }; 8 void fun(NODE*list,int x) 9 { 10 11 } 12 void main() 13 { 14 int x; 15 NODE*head,*p; 16 /*首先建立只有辅助袁元的空链表*/ 17 head=new NODE; 18 head->next=NULL; 19 std::cout<<’...
用链表表示的数据的简单选择排序,结点的域为数据域data,指针域next;链表首指针为head,链表无头结点。【南京理工大学2000三、2(6分)】 Selectsoe t(head) p=head; while (p(1) ) {q=p; r=(2) while((3) ) {if ((4) ) q=r; r=(5) ; } tmp=q一>data; q一>data=p一>da... ...
空闲链表分为空闲盘块链和空闲盘区链。 A. 正确 B. 错误 查看完整题目与答案 空闲表法属于连续分配方式。 A. 正确 B. 错误 查看完整题目与答案 隐式链接对于随机访问的效率很高。 A. 正确 B. 错误 查看完整题目与答案 在分页时,每个进程拥有一个页表,且页表驻留在内存中。 A. 正确 B. ...
一、redis (1)、redis是一个key-value存储系统。和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。这些数据类型都支持push/pop、add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的。在此基础上,red...
线程申请内存: 先查找线程私有变量看是否已经存在一个arena, 如果有就对该arena加锁然后分配内存, 如果没有, 就去循环链表找没加锁的arena. 如果arena都加锁了, 那么malloc就会开辟新的arena, 将该arena加入循环链表, 用该arena分配内存. chunk的组织 使用中chunk结构: chunk指针指向chunk的起始...
选择题一般会考察一些基础概念和简单的程序解读;简答题的考察和选择题中的基础概念考察有些类似,建议复习时多关注特定的名词解释和关联的知识,比如函数重载、递归、面向对象的特性、一些关键字(static、inline、enum...)等;写完整的程序,一...
4.若线性表最常用的操作是存取第I个元素及其前驱和后继元素的值,为节省时间应采用的存储方式是B双向链表C单循环链表D顺序表
百度试题 题目折半查找只适用与有序表,包括有序的顺序表和有序的链表。 A.正确B.错误相关知识点: 试题来源: 解析 A 反馈 收藏
小红同学在家里建立了小小化学实验室,(初三的化学 }小红同学在家里建立了小小化学实验室,她收集到下列物质:(1)铜片 (2)硫(3)氧化铁 (4)石灰水 (5)大理石 (6)醋(7)自来水 .准备按单质,化合物 混合物分类存放,请你帮她完成 物质{———物——— {———物 {(1)单质———(2)化合物 你能再帮他...
在单链表存储结构中,线性表的表长等于单链表中数据元素的结点个数,即除了头结点以外的结点的个数。通常通过头指针 head来访问一个单链表。已知单链表结构如下:typedef struct node{DataType data;struct node * next;}Node, * LinkList;设计求表长的算法,要求算法返回表长。 查看完整题目与答案 试论小学语文教...